Abstract :
The mechanism of antiphospholipid syndrome (APS) development is still not completely understood. Accumulating evidence indicates that β2-glycoprotein I (β2GPI), is the major target antigen for antiphospholipid (aPL) antibodies, which play a crucial role in the pathogenesis of this autoimmune condition. Knowledge about the molecular structure, biological characteristics and function of β2GPI has been expanding in recent years. In this review, we have focused on some recent important findings on β2GPI and anti-β2GPI antibodies in patients and animal models with APS
